Surnames: Dixon, Adkisson, Blaser Lois Ruth Dixon, 76, a resident of The Dalles, died at her home on Saturday, April 12, 2003. She was born November 2, 1926, in The Dalles, the only child to Hans and Agnes (Adkisson) Blaser. She grew up in The Dalles and graduated from The Dalles High School in 1943. She married Robert Dale Dixon in September 1943, in Denver, Colorado. While he was in the Air Force, she worked for her parents at The Dalles Soda Works. In 1956, they bought the Pendleton (Oregon) Bottling Company and operated there until 1987. After selling the bottling company, they moved to the Washington coast. Both had their pilot's license and flew up and down the West Coast. She was a member of the Eastern Star and was Past Matron in The Dalles, and she was active with her sorority in Ocean Park, Washington. She enjoyed making her floral arrangements for weddings and conventions. She also enjoyed national and world ice skating competitions, her home at the beach, and gardening. She is survived by several cousins and her friends. Her husband preceded her in death. At her request, there will be no services held. Private cremation was held at The Dalles Win-quatt Crematory with Smith Callaway Chapel in care of arrangements. Memorials may be made to Hospice of the Gorge, 751 Myrtle Street, The Dalles, Oregon 97058. The Dalles Chronicle April 15, 2003. (Copied from [email protected] mail list) Death Notice San Luis Obispo Co. Telegram-Tribune Wed 12-14-1988 KIMBALL- Mable, 86, of Morro Bay died Tuesday in a San Luis Obispo hospital. Services are pending at Reis Chapel in San Luis Obispo. Obituary Telegram-Tribune Thurs. 12-15-1988 Mable H. KIMBALL, 86, of Morro Bay died Tuesday, December 13, 1988, in a San Luis Obispo convalescent hospital. Services will be at 1 pm Saturday in Hope Chapel at Forest Lawn Memorial Park in Cypress. Mrs. KIMBALL was born March 19, 1902, in Pendleton, Oregon. She had been a finger- print supervisor for the Las Angeles Police Department for 25 years. She retired in 1982 and moved to Morro Bay, coming from Fort James where she lived for 10 years. Her husband, Joseph S. KIMBALL, died in 1963. They were married in 1925 in Las Angeles. She is survived by two daughters, Cherie KIMBALL of Morro Bay and Theo Joan KRING of Irvine; one sister, Vada HOEFT of Oregon; one granddaughter; and three great-grandchildren. Donations may be made to the American Heart Association or to the Alzheimer's Foundation, P.O. Box 121 Santa Barbara 93102 Reis Chapel in San Luis Obispo is handling the arrangements. Daily East Oregonian Pendleton, Umatilla Co., Oregon Saturday, September 6, 1919 Gertrude LEWIS passed away Thursday morning at the St. Anthony hospital in Pendleton. She has been in poor health for some time. She is survived by her father, Henry LEWIS, and two brothers and a sister, Hattie. The remains were taken to Athena and services will be held at N. A. MillerÂ’s undertaking parlors today at 2 p. m. The remains will be buried at Athena. Re MARTHA PRICKETT There is no obituary for her. I found this information in "Munselle Funeral Home Records , Milton-Freewater, Ore." compiled by Garland Wilson. Prickett, Martha widow born 4 Mar 1845, Ohio to Samuel (born Virginia) and Esther Owens (born Pennsylvania) Fickness. D 5 Jan 1929 Eastern Oregon State Hospital, Pendleton, Ore. Heart disease. Buried 9 Jan 1929 Milton, Ore IOOF Blk R Lot 4 Space 3. From "Cemetery Inscription Milton-Freewater, Oregon 1884-1984" compiled by Iris and Garland Wilson ....RINGER, Martha Prichet 1846-1929 is buried that location.
